Paracord Camo Belt with Metal Buckle. The Paracord Camo Belt is 46 inches long has 93.5 feet of 550 paracord. It is adjustable and can be used as an everyday belt but has other uses in a survival mode or emergency situation. If the belt is unbraided it can be used as a car tow strap, tourniquet, repelling harness, restraints, or an emergency zip line harness. The unwrapped paracord can be used to build shelter, raise or lower a bucket or tools, fishing line, fishing net, tie down, and many other uses.
Paracord (parachute cord) is a lightweight nylon rope originally used in the suspension lines of US parachutes during World War II. Once in the field, paratroopers found this cord useful for many other tasks. This versatile cord is now used as a general purpose utility cord by both military personnel and civilians.
